Handover note — appointment reminder job (Briarhealth)

For the release manager: I'm handing the clinic appointment reminder job to Soren after Friday's cut. The job runs nightly, pulls from the Wrenfield scheduler, and sends reminders two days out. Known quirk: it skips silently if the template bundle checksum fails. The template bundle is encrypted at rest; redeploying it after a release requires the recovery passphrase noted below.

vault phrase of tajop-haduf = holath-brivan-wenax

Subject: Handover — snapshot pipeline

Hey — quick handover before I'm out. Snapshot tests for the Quillboard UI components are green, but the baseline refresh job runs tonight at 01:00. If diffs flood in, re-bless only the button set. Pushing blessed baselines to the artifact store needs the signing key, pasted below.

rollout seal: bky9_PeXH1fTLY

As part of the Quillbus broker upgrade from v4 to v5, all consumers must re-authenticate against the new control plane. The legacy plaintext listener is disabled; only mutual-TLS endpoints remain. Migration scripts live in the ops-runbooks repo and were reviewed last sprint. For your audit, the staging environment mirrors production topology exactly. Staging access for verification uses the credential that follows.

API key for yahig-tadup: kto7_ubizbYm